SEEBURGER USA grows 204% in Cloud Customer Total Contract Value

Fundamental shift in purchasing EDI & ERP cloud, on premise and hybrid solutions

03/31/2014

ATLANTA, GA – SEEBURGER is seeing strong growth in Cloud Services customers due to a fundamental shift in how customers are buying integration and secure managed file transfer solutions.

"SEEBURGER USA grew its total contract value for new Cloud Service customers by 204% in 2013, selling solutions to SMB's and large enterprises, demonstrating the breath of the product offering to suit a range of company sizes," said US Vice President of Sales Bill Metallo.

 

As a global integration leader, SEEBURGER supports 9,100 plus companies worldwide, with an expanding market in North America. SEEBURGER’s Cloud Service is based on its Business Integration Suite (BIS), its flagship product which is a single architected platform engineered from the ground up.

 

With over 20 years of experience in selling business integration solutions in the B2B/EDI/EAI area, the SEEBURGER cloud offering was designed with input from long standing ties with industry. The result is a cloud service offering that demonstrates an understanding across verticals and supply chain processes.

 

"Many companies have a mix of cloud and on premise applications that require ERP process integration with effective end to end visibility," said Metallo. "Additionally our customers are telling us that they need reductions in total cost and lead time while meeting the business’s requirements for extending critical electronic processes to critical trading partners with minimal downtime."

Featuring proven best practices for integration and secure file transfer of structured or unstructured data, the SEEBURGER Cloud also has a data center which passes the most stringent security audits and is ISO 27001 certified, ensuring compliance for international IT services management.

 

"Greater understanding of leveraging cloud solutions as a part of an ERP or EDI strategy, such as using cloud as an adaptor to connect existing systems, databases and applications to the ERP, increased confidence in security with options such as our private cloud offering and a move towards regular monthly forecasting of IT spend, are all factors contributing to the rising interest in cloud computing," said Metallo.
